United Arab Emirates is one of the most famous and attractive travel destinations in the world. It is a must to obtain the Tourist Visa to enter the emirates territories

The Standard Travel Visas options are for 30 Days and 60 Days. It is possible for the tourists to extend their visa for 30 Days twice. 

The main authorities who are responsible for issuing the Visas are The Federal Authority for Identity, Citizenship, Customs and Port Security (ICP) and the General Directorate of Residency & The Foreigners Affairs in each emirate (GDRFA).

The rules for immigration and rules for visas are altered on a yearly basis. Tourists must pay attention to the latest set of rules which are in play during the given year if they wish to visit the UAE. 

Travellers will be willing or forced to go for a UAE tourist visa extension because they have more places to explore, due to unavoidable circumstances such as the delays and cancellations in the flights, the closure of the airports, runaways and airspace, medical emergencies of the individuals on board, passport loss or theft and family emergencies. 
 

Understanding UAE Tourist Visa Extensions in 2026

Types of UAE Tourist Visas (30 Days and 60 Days Visas)

The most common options for the Tourist Visa are the 30 Days and 60 Days Visa. 

Extension Options Available in 2026

A tourist is able to extend both the 30 and 60 Days Visas for 30 Days for 2 times. 

How Many Times a UAE Tourist Visa Can Be Extended?

A Tourist Visa can be extended twice for 30 days. 

Difference between Visa Extension and Visa Change

The Visa Extension allows you to stay longer with the extension in the same visa category. The Visa change allows you to change your visa category to another type. Changing the Visa type from Job Seeker Visa to Work Visa can be provided as an example.

Mistake 1: Waiting until the Last Day to Apply

Risks of Last Minute Applications

Applying for the visa last minute can be a very risky task. There might be delays even if you are applying through the ICP and the GDRFA Official Sites. The officers will not be on duty during Saturday and Sunday, public holidays and vacation time.

Possible Delays in Processing

The process might get delayed if there are public holidays, school holidays or if it is the weekend. Sometimes the requests of the travel agencies might take time because the priority is given to the crowd who has applied through the official portals. 

It might take time to process during the peak season because of the high number of applications to process.  

Recommended Timeframe to Apply for Extension

It is wise to apply for a Visa Extension at least 3 to 5 business days before the expiry date of the visa. The time period should exclude the public holidays and the weekend. 

Mistake 2: Misunderstanding the UAE Grace Period

What the Grace Period Actually Means?

A grace period is a certain amount of days provided from your visa expiration date to renew or extend it. It was in operation before the year 2026 under the visitor visa laws. 

When The Grace Period Applies?

The grace period is abolished according the latest updates of the Immigration rules in 2026. You will no longer be entitled to a grace period after the expiry date to renew your visa. 

How Overstay Fines Can Start Accumulating?

Overstaying fines will start accumulating if you stay after the expiry date mentioned on your visa. The standard daily amount as of the 2026 policy updates is 50 AED. 
 

Mistake 3: Not Checking Passport Validity

Minimum Passport Validity Required

The Visitor’s Passport should be valid for at least 6 months from the date of the entry in the UAE. 

Problems Caused by An Expiring Passport

UAE Immigration authorities will not accept the visas or the extensions of the passport which are about to be expired or which have expired. 

How to Resolve Passport Validity Issues?

It is a must to provide updates and accurate information regarding the passport validity. You have to get a new passport before you travel from the territory you are in. 

You have to contact the nearby embassy of your country for the emergency travel documents or apply online through the official portals of the respective country. 
 

Mistake 4: Using Unauthorized Visa Agents

Scams and Unreliable Visa Services

You should to choose a travel agent who is registered with The Federal Authority for Identity, Citizenship, Customs and Port Security. You should make sure that your travel agent is reputed and reliable. 

Delays or Rejected Applications

UAE tourist visa extension done through unreliable and unrecognized travel agents will cause you delays. There are instances where your application might get rejected and your passport gets blacklisted. 

Benefits of Choosing Authorized Visa Providers

The Federal Authority for Identity, Citizenship, Customs and Port Security (ICP) and the General Directorate of Residency &The Foreigners Affairs in each emirate (GDRFA) are the main bodies who are responsible for issuing visa.  Recognized travel agencies also act as authorized Visa providers. 
 

Mistake 5: Providing Documents and Information which are Incorrect or Incomplete

Required Documents for Visa Extension

A Tourist who is hoping to extend visa must have the following documents.
 
• Passport - The original passport should be provided. It should be valid for at least 6 months beyond the extension form.
• Clear digital copy of the current visa 
• A clear photograph which is passport-sized
• Verified contact details
• The form of Application (if required only)

Common Errors in Applications

An individual might provide incorrect application forms. There are times when an applicant will miss the deadlines. An applicant might submit insufficient or incorrect documentation. All of these instances will be marked as errors during the application process.  

Tips for Submitting Correct Documents

You have to make sure that you have the digital and physical copies of all the required documents. You have to make sure that the passport is valid for at least 6 months and all the documents that you are providing are valid. 
 

Mistake 6: Not Paying Attention to Overstay Penalties and Fines

Daily Overstay Fines in The UAE

You are supposed to pay a fine of 50 AED in UAE daily for overstaying. The amount is accumulated daily until you renew the visa from the day your visa expires. 

How Fines Can Accumulate Quickly?

You will be charged with the daily from the day your visa expires till the day your visa is renewed. 

What is the method to clear Fines before Leaving UAE?

You have to pay for an Exit Permit of 250 to 300 AED before leaving the country at the departure if you decide to overstay without extending your visa.
